Transaction ef06734ab4d4c86d8bdd87f957b1d59a3333c7d2443ed6b989a7c713f4bce8c4
1 Input
1 Output
-
ef06734ab4d4c86d8bdd87f957b1d59a3333c7d2443ed6b989a7c713f4bce8c4:0
- value
- 754751
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d9d2663ef34d2519bff4317efe935dc1549a06d OP_EQUAL
- address
- 3MtoWugR3gM3Dh7RHgyghYDvPLUkEaPu4h